Offers an account of how banking evolved in the United States in the context of the nation's political and social development. This book highlights not only the influence politicians exercised over banking but also how banking drove political interests and created political coalitions.

Peter Albin is known for his seminal work in applying the concepts of adaptive dynamical systems, first developed by biologists and physicists, to the study of economic systems. This book is a collection of his pathbreaking articles on the application of cellular automata and complexity theory to economic problems.

The thinking of John Maynard Keynes is still relevant to successful development of the advanced capitalistic system as is shown by evolution of economic thinking since World War II. The changes in economic thinking in the United States and in the world are described, with a chapter devoted to each presidency from Eisenhower to Clinton.

Behavioral economics has revolutionized the way economists view the world. This volume makes the case for a greater use of behavioral ideas in six fields - public economics, development, law and economics, health, wage determination, and organizational economics. It is intended policymakers, sociologists, psychologists, as well as economists.

A study of the repercussions of Beirut's role as a financial, trade and banking centre in the Middle East during Lebanon's post-independence years. It investigates the impact of its involvement in steering the Lebanese social structure and economy to meet the needs of capitalist expansion.

Game theory is central to modern understandings of how people deal with problems of coordination and cooperation. Yet, ironically, it cannot give a straightforward explanation of some of the simplest forms of human coordination and cooperation. This book proposes a revision of game theory that resolves these problems.

Economic theory, which explains efficiency using formalized rational choice models, often simplifies human behavior to the point of distortion. This work finds such theory to be particularly weak in explaining such crucial forms of economic behavior as cooperation, innovation, and action under conditions of uncertainty.
